Output d512329b1c693b182a30b2feb56adcdbb529af9738a3d8e3171edff050e8e770:0

value
406814
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1daf621b35f745d4b79eb58a96aa22fb1064d8d2 OP_EQUAL
address
34PycwtPtPT33R6JWA3i76R3oNf5muj51Z
transaction
d512329b1c693b182a30b2feb56adcdbb529af9738a3d8e3171edff050e8e770
spent
true